WRITE_PORT_BUFFER_USHORT-Funktion (wdm.h)
Die WRITE_PORT_BUFFER_USHORT Routine schreibt eine Reihe von USHORT-Werten aus einem Puffer in die angegebene Portadresse.
Syntax
NTHALAPI VOID WRITE_PORT_BUFFER_USHORT(
[in] PUSHORT Port,
[in] PUSHORT Buffer,
[in] ULONG Count
);
Parameter
[in] Port
Zeiger auf den Port, der ein zugeordneter Speicherbereich im E/A-Raum sein muss.
[in] Buffer
Zeiger auf einen Puffer, aus dem ein Array von USHORT-Werten geschrieben werden soll.
[in] Count
Gibt die Anzahl der USHORT-Werte an, die an den Port geschrieben werden sollen.
Rückgabewert
Keine
Bemerkungen
Die Größe des Puffers muss groß genug sein, um mindestens die angegebene Anzahl von USHORT-Werten zu enthalten.
Aufrufer von WRITE_PORT_BUFFER_USHORT können in jedem IRQL ausgeführt werden, vorausgesetzt, der Puffer ist resident und der Port ist resident, zugeordneter Gerätespeicher.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Verfügbar ab Windows 2000. |
Zielplattform | Universell |
Header | wdm.h (include Wdm.h, Ntddk.h, Ntifs.h, Miniport.h) |
Bibliothek | Hal.lib |
IRQL | Beliebige Ebene (siehe Abschnitt "Hinweise") |